Overview of Ciel Senior Living of the Tri-cities Memory Care

Ciel Senior Living of the Tri-cities Memory Care is a dedicated memory care community in Kennewick, Washington, specializing in care for those living with Alzheimer’s and other forms of dementia throughout Benton County and the broader Tri-Cities region. The community has an active license through the Washington Department of Social and Health Services through August 2026 under license #2448. With 48 of 69 beds occupied, the community is currently at approximately 70%, close to the state average, with open availability for interested families.

The community has completed four state inspections, which is below the Washington average of nine, with the most recent life safety inspection, on October 28, 2025, reporting zero deficiencies and confirming that previously cited fire safety issues had been fully resolved. Earlier inspections, on the other hand, had identified concerns such as gaps in documentation, improper storage of combustible materials, and issues with emergency exit signage. There was also a substantiated complaint involving the delayed reporting of suspected resident abuse. However, no fines or license suspensions were reported. The most recent deficiency-free inspection signifies a meaningful improvement in operations and oversight.

In addition to comprehensive memory care, programming, 24-hour staffing, rehabilitation services, and short-term respite care are provided. Dining also focuses on fresh ingredients with a variety of meal options designed to meet individual preferences and needs. With its convenient location in Kennewick, the community provides easier access to families in the Tri-Cities area, including nearby Richland and Pasco, to a specialized dementia care option without the need to travel to a larger metropolitan area.

Ciel Senior Living of the Tri-cities Memory Care is an appealing choice for older adults in the early to advanced stages of Alzheimer’s disease or other dementia-related conditions seeking a secure and purpose-built environment. The availability of respite care also makes it a practical option for families seeking temporary support.

Inspection Report Summary for Ciel Senior Living of the Tri-Cities Memory Care

The most recent inspection on October 28, 2025, found no deficiencies and confirmed that all previous fire safety violations had been corrected. Earlier inspections showed multiple fire safety deficiencies related to documentation, storage of combustible materials, and emergency egress signage, as well as issues with policy adherence and reporting in a substantiated complaint investigation regarding resident abuse. Inspectors cited problems primarily with fire safety maintenance and emergency procedures, along with failures in abuse reporting protocols. The complaint investigations included one substantiated case involving delayed reporting of suspected abuse, while other complaints were unsubstantiated or related to fire safety concerns with no injuries or emergency response. The facility’s record shows improvement over time, with recent inspections clearing previously noted deficiencies.
